- Da PodeBib "In a skilfully refurbished farmhouse nestled in the hills surrounding San Gimignano, Da Pode restaurant welcomes guests into cosy dining rooms featuring stone and wood, and onto a large terrace where, when the weather is warm, diners can enjoy their meal as they admire the Tuscan countryside. The cuisine is authentic and deeply rooted in tradition, with recipes handed down through four generations. - San Martino 26 Occupying the wine cellars of an old palazzo in the historic centre, this restaurant has a fashionable feel with just a few tables and a selection of contemporary - style dishes inspired by classic recipes (from Tuscany and elsewhere) on the menu.338m
